How to Use Projectors to Learn Real Night Sky Patterns
Indoor projectors are best used as “flight simulators” for the actual night sky. Before heading outdoors, guide the child in identifying three specific constellations on the ceiling.
Once they can reliably name and find these patterns in a controlled environment, the likelihood of successful identification in the field increases significantly. Focus on grouping stars into familiar shapes, which aids in long-term memory retention and spatial pattern recognition.
Choosing Features That Grow With Your Child’s Interest
The secret to buying for a child is to prioritize modularity or adjustability. A projector with interchangeable discs or variable focus allows the device to evolve alongside the child’s burgeoning skills.
- Ages 5–7: Prioritize ease of use, durability, and colorful imagery.
- Ages 8–10: Focus on interactive discs and manual controls that teach celestial mechanics.
- Ages 11–14: Look for high-resolution projection and technical features that mirror professional astronomy software.
Always assess whether a product can be easily resold or handed down to a younger sibling. High-quality optical devices often hold their value better than novelty plastic projectors.
Transitioning From Indoor Mapping to Outdoor Stargazing
The ultimate goal of indoor astronomy prep is to build the confidence required for outdoor observation. Once a child feels like an “expert” at identifying Orion or Ursa Major on their bedroom wall, they are far more likely to brave the cold of an actual stargazing session.
When the time comes to step outside, bring the knowledge gained indoors with you. Use the projector as a reference point for what to expect, but celebrate the imperfections and vastness of the real night sky as the final, most exciting step in their development.
